Banner Solutions Acquires Herbert L. Flake

On April 1, 2021, Banner Solutions acquired distribution company Herbert L. Flake from Supply Chain Equity Partners

Target Company

Herbert L. Flake

Houston, Texas, United States
Herbert L. Flake is a value added business-to-business distributor of security hardware & access control products. Herbert L. Flake was founded in 1912 and is based in Houston, Texas.

DESCRIPTION

Banner Solutions is a wholesale distributor of door hardware, electronic access control, and security products primarily for repair, replacement, and renovation applications in the commercial/institutional and residential markets. Banner Solutions was founded in 1987 and is based in Kansas City, Missouri.

DESCRIPTION

Supply Chain Equity Partners (SCEP) is a private equity firm focused exclusively on the distribution sector. The Firm specifically targets wholesale distributors and related logistics companies that are a critical link in the supply chain. SCEP will consider a variety of transaction situations, including new platform acquisitions, corporate divestitures, underperforming companies, and add-ons. Supply Chain Equity Partners is based in Cleveland, Ohio.
